Markets Cube is a Forex and CFDs broker, owned and operated by Prisma Global LTD, incorporated in the Marshall Islands - one of the popular offshore destinations for unregulated brokers. There is one more company behind the brand's name - PayOpt Services LTD, whose registered address is in Limassol, Cyprus provides all payments processing services to Prisma Global LTD. The broker doesn't provide any office location info as well as the regulation details. Seems like it is one more offshore-based forex broker that has no license and trading with such an entity can only bring a lot of trouble for the investors.
We advise all investors and traders to avoid Markets Cube and other unregulated brokers. The lack of information about the broker’s regulations, trading conditions, and contact details should be the biggest red flag for those who plan to invest with the entity. Usually, such companies run investment scams. Traders should trade with well-regulated brokers such as UK brokers or brokers in Australia and reliable brokers such as FP Markets and HotForex.
Based on our findings, the Markets Cube website is inactive. This means the broker has muted its trading offering and does not operate. However, we recommend avoiding and staying alert in case of any proposals.
